Gophers eat grain and plant material but moles eat worms, grubs and insects. Very different in the way you can control. So be sure of what you have before you attempt control. There are no legal or effective grain based poisons for moles that I am aware of. If you have MOLES, traps are the way to go and I agree with the above posters that the Out of Site (oos) mole trap works very well.
